Various domains of the HSA molecule have also been used to make bioconjugates with increased stability, better targeting properties, and/or extended half-lives in blood. Bovine collagen type II, a fibrillar collagen mainly found in cartilage, comprises 24 potentially glycosylated lysine residues within its collagen domain. The P4H activity and the large number of 4-Hyp residues that are formed, amounting to half of all the Pro residues or 10% of all residues, have been identified as having a clear role in the structure and chemistry of the triple helix [3].
